Smart Module Design: Innovation in Learning Media Technology-Based Character Education
Abstract
The purpose of this study is to determine whether the Smart Module learning media is valid for use and how the student learning outcomes are after using this module. The success or failure of a learning process, especially in Islamic religious education that focuses on character education, is determined by the learning media used. In realizing this success, a problem arises, namely that teachers are still monotonous in using learning media so that learning cannot be received properly by students. Seeing this problem, researchers created a new innovation, the Smart Module, a technology-based character education learning media innovation, namely technology that can combine the virtual world with the real world at the same time. This study uses the R & D type with the Borg and Gall development model. Data collection techniques are carried out through observation, questionnaires, literature studies, documentation and trials, then analyzed using media expert validation analysis techniques, material expert validation analysis techniques and trial analysis techniques. The results of this study indicate that the Smart Module has a validity level of 92% and can improve student learning outcomes.
